- At the time when Cromwell invaded this country and burned monasteries and churches, he divided the land on the outskirts of the town of Cobh into fields. He built stone walls around them. Some of these old walls are still in existance and to be seen here especially in Ballinacrusha, Ballyleary, and Ballydulea. Grass and moss are covering them now. It is said that he gave an equal share of these divisions to some of his followers at the time.
